
President Trump’s highly anticipated “Big Beautiful Bill” has been making waves across the country, with significant implications for various sectors of society. While the bill promises tax cuts, student loan reforms, and stricter rules for Medicaid and SNAP, experts are raising concerns about the potential ethical implications of these changes.
The bill, which has been hailed by the administration as a landmark piece of legislation, is set to impact millions of Americans. However, critics argue that the bill’s focus on tax cuts and reductions in social welfare programs could disproportionately affect vulnerable populations, including low-income families, students, and the elderly.
One of the key provisions of the bill is the repeal of student loan forgiveness programs, which could have a significant impact on individuals struggling with student debt. Experts warn that this move could exacerbate the student debt crisis and limit access to higher education for many Americans.
Additionally, the bill includes significant cuts to Medicaid and SNAP, programs that provide essential support to low-income families. Critics argue that these cuts could leave millions of Americans without access to vital healthcare and nutrition services, further widening existing health and wealth disparities.
Furthermore, the bill’s tax cuts, while promising relief for many Americans, have raised concerns about increasing income inequality. Experts warn that these cuts could disproportionately benefit the wealthy while leaving lower-income individuals behind.
